What will a Roof Inspection accomplish? 

Roofing inspectors are likely to do more than climb onto the roof to inspect the tiles. They'll give a thorough analysis of the condition that the roofing is in, which includes roof material and flashing around vents, chimneys, ridges and caps and drip edges. The homeowner will also receive a report. with an assessment of the drainage on the roof, including the downspouts and gutters.

If it's determined that repairs are needed then they must be completed prior to the roof certification being issued. If repairs aren't needed the roof inspector would offer an estimate of the time the roof will last, and a certificate will be issued. The roofing certifications can last for 5 years or more, however, they can vary from one section of the roofing to the other.

Many different aspects will be considered when evaluating the property. The most important are the roof's pitch as well as the type of roof (single tile, single shake and so on.) as well as the number of roofing layers as well as any previous repairs that might be present on the roof. This will all be recorded in the report on a roof inspection.

Sell Your Home Using an Inspection of the Roof

Although a lot of emphasis is placed on the necessity of an inspection of the roof from the buyer's point of view, however, it's important to think about getting a roof inspection done prior to selling their house. If a homeowner is able to provide the most recent inspection and certificate for potential buyers, it can assist in putting buyers at ease and allow them to feel at ease before buying an investment property. If a homeowner does not give potential buyers an inspection of their roof or certification, they'll have to purchase one themselves and include it as a condition of the contract.
